TUNA MACARONI SALAD INGREDIENTS
You will need:
- 1 (16oz) box of elbow macoroni or shells
- 2 (5oz) cans of tuna in water
- 1 cup mayo or miracle whip
- 2 stalks of celery (diced)
- 1/2 white onion (diced)
- salt and pepper to taste

HOW TO MAKE TUNA MACARONI SALAD
STEP ONE: Cook pasta according to package.
STEP TWO: Strain water from noodles after cooked then combine tuna (drained), diced onion, diced celery, and mayo.
STEP THREE: Salt and pepper to taste, mix well, and serve chilled.
Substitutions
- You can use any small shaped pasta you’d like, I prefer shells or elbows for this recipe!
- Mayo or miracle whip both work great for macaroni salad.
